Prince William’s Pre-Wedding Dinner for Royal Guests hosted by Lady Elizabeth Anson, the Queen’s cousin, at the Mandarin Oriental Hotel in London on this day in 2011, on the eve of the Wedding. While the bride and groom weren’t present (spending the evening quietly), the rest of the entire British Royal Family was in attendance, including the Queen and Duke of Edinburgh, Princes of Wales and Duchess of Cornwall (wearing her 4-strand Pearl Choker with small Diamond Clasp, and leaving early), the Princess Royal (in Empress Maria Feodorovna’s Sapphire Choker) and Sir Tim, the Duke of York, the Earl and Countess of Wessex, the Duke and Duchess of Gloucester (wearing the Gloucester Pearl and Emerald Suite), the Duke and Duchess of Kent (in her Diamond Flower Suite), Princess Alexandra (wearing Grand Duchess Elena Vladimirovna’s Emerald Choker), and Prince and Princess Michael of Kent with their various children and spouses.
Embed from Getty ImagesEmbed from Getty ImagesEmbed from Getty ImagesEmbed from Getty ImagesEmbed from Getty ImagesEmbed from Getty ImagesEmbed from Getty ImagesEmbed from Getty ImagesEmbed from Getty ImagesEmbed from Getty ImagesEmbed from Getty ImagesEmbed from Getty Images
Foreign Royal Guests included Queen Margrethe II of Denmark (wearing her Antique Diamond Earrings and Queen Josefina’s Diamond Brooches), King Harald and Queen Sonja of Norway (in Queen Maud’s Drapers’ Company Brooch and her Diamond Filigree Brooch), the King and Queen of Malaysia, the Sultan and Queen Saleha of Brunei, Queen Sofia, Crown Prince Felipe and Crown Princess Letizia of Spain, King Constantine, Queen Anne Marie (in Diamond Filigree Brooch), Crown Prince Pavlos, Crown Princess Marie Chantal (wearing her JAR Earrings), Prince Nikolaos, and Princess Tatiana of Greece, Grand Duke Henri and Grand Duchess Maria Theresa of Luxembourg (in Princess Ingeborg’s Pearl Brooch), Prince Albert and Princess Charlene of Monaco, the King of Swaziland, Crown Princess Victoria and Prince Daniel of Sweden, Crown Prince Philippe and Crown Princess Mathilde of Belgium (wearing Queen Fabiola’s Waterfall Brooch), the Crown Prince of Abu Dhabi, Prince Seeiso and Princess Mabereng of Lesotho, Crown Prince Alexander and Crown Princess Katherine of Serbia (in her Diamond Chain-Link Suite), and the Crown Prince of Dubai.

Meanwhile, Catherine Middleton spent the evening with her parents and family at the Goring Hotel in London, while Prince William and Prince Harry were at Clarence House, making a surprise appearance to greet well-wishers who had lined the processional route.
